“Too Soon For New Britney Spears Album,” Friends Say

Britney’s back, but is it all happening too fast? Friends of the Spears family think so, and they are speaking out on what they perceive as Jive Records’ hast to shoo the multiplatinum-selling pop singer back into the studio before she’s had time to recover from a year of custody disputes, tabloid headlines, and emotional breakdowns.
“Britney has been going to the studio ever since she got out of the hospital, but it was more a therapeutic exercise than anything,” says a source close to the Spears family tell MSNBC. “The people who really care about her knew that even though she wants to be the pop star she used to be, it won’t be good for her. Even her label, Jive, understood that. It’s a little unsettling to us that they’d want her to get back to recording so fast.”
Britney Spears will release her fifth studio album, Circus, on December 2, which is also her 27th birthday.
